Cryptological Dividers
1633

Joachim Deuerlin

Used to encode and decode secret messages, these dividers are topped by striking openwork. When the disk is turned to select a letter with the pointer at the top, the spikes protruding from the bottom move accordingly, changing the distance between them. Letters are thus converted into distances and recorded as lines of corresponding length.
